Z-5500 vs actual car stereo?

Hey guys,

So before you all starting beating down my idea with an iron rod let me explain :P.

Basically as some of you may know I am going to be getting a new car.

Now with this car I'm basically going to leave it as it is, and maybe change a bit of the stereo, that's it.

At home in my room I have my set of z-5500's and was thinking, that maybe I could hook those up into my car, of course with an inverter (about 100$).

Or I could always just say add a sub and an amp and get the same result...

Ideas/suggestions?

If It were me, I'd just invest in better speakers for the car, add a sub, maybe try & get a better head unit (one that can support 5.1) along with one of those center channel speakers that mount on or in dash, etc...

would be cheaper with what your thinking, but it would suck, as you'd have to figure out where to mount the speakers etc etc, & would be a real pain in the arse.

I'd go for the 2nd idea, add a sub & amp, & if you can, replace the factory speakers (if they are factory speakers in car) to compliment the sub & amp, as well as the head unit.
